Square Spot Design
Square Spot Design is an innovative idea agency based in Manchester, NH, dedicated to working with mission-driven organizations since 2000. They specialize in delivering sharp conceptual creativity alongside strategic messaging, tackling projects that aim to improve communities, advocate for cleaner air, and stimulate local economies.
The team's approach is characterized by a blend of professionalism and engaging collaboration, ensuring that client participation is integral to achieving meaningful outcomes. Their commitment to creativity extends beyond design, fostering an environment that encourages critical thinking and the transformation of great ideas into impactful realities.
Generated from the website
Also at this address
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.
Partial Data by Foursquare.